Erustus Kanga's career is marked by a rare combination of academic excellence and public service. He holds a PhD and the title of Professor, alongside two national honours that few Kenyans ever receive. His leadership during the 2026 Amboseli elephant crisis demonstrated his ability to act decisively under pressure, while his advocacy for rhino habitat expansion shows his long-term vision. These achievements have earned him respect not only in Kenya but also in the international conservation community.

Records & Feats
Led the first confirmed cyanide poisoning investigation in Kenyan elephants
Under Kanga's direction, KWS confirmed that 15 elephants in Amboseli died from cyanide poisoning, likely from contaminated tomatoes, marking a rare and significant forensic wildlife investigation.
